Transaction 643e4185d0875715c5b8723c32f09086ad9056eadc4971d17a8e6955226f0473

1 Input
2 Outputs
  • 643e4185d0875715c5b8723c32f09086ad9056eadc4971d17a8e6955226f0473:0
  • value  109528071
    address  2ND2QRRtx6FfmVea5JwB57Sh59a6DCbBo22
  • 643e4185d0875715c5b8723c32f09086ad9056eadc4971d17a8e6955226f0473:1
  • value  1046755
    address  mq48PXpAtEWJ9iQXWXZjXTbVFVzZZGSNCj